简介
Mandarina-cli 是一个基于 Node.js 的命令行工具集,主要用于快速创建前端项目模板、自动化构建和打包部署等工作。它可以帮助前端工程师更高效地完成日常工作,提高开发效率和代码质量。
安装
在使用 Mandarina-cli 之前,需要先安装 Node.js 和 npm。安装好之后,可以通过以下命令安装 mandarina-cli:
npm install -g mandarina-cli
命令行工具
以下是 mandarina-cli 提供的一些命令行工具:
create
mandarina create <template-name>
通过该命令可以根据指定的模板名称创建一个全新的前端项目。例如:
mandarina create vue
将会在当前目录下创建一个 Vue.js 项目。
当前支持的模板包括:vue、react、angular、static(静态网站)等。
init
mandarina init
通过该命令可以初始化一个前端项目,包括 package.json、webpack.config.js、babel.config.js 等文件的配置。
dev
mandarina dev
通过该命令可以开启一个本地服务器,实现前端静态资源的访问和调试。
build
mandarina build
通过该命令可以对前端项目进行打包和构建,生成压缩后的文件和代码。
deploy
mandarina deploy
通过该命令可以将前端项目部署到云服务器上,实现线上代码的发布和运行。
使用示例
以下是一个使用 mandarina-cli 创建并运行一个 Vue.js 项目的示例:
- 安装 mandarina-cli:
npm install -g mandarina-cli
; - 创建一个新的 Vue.js 项目:
mandarina create vue
; - 进入项目目录:
cd vue
; - 运行本地服务器:
mandarina dev
; - 在浏览器中访问 http://localhost:8080/,即可查看运行效果。
总结
Mandarina-cli 是一个非常实用的前端命令行工具集,可以极大地帮助前端工程师提高工作效率和代码质量。在实际的开发过程中,我们可以根据自己的项目需要,选择合适的工具和命令进行使用,从而更好地完成日常工作。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/600671d730d0927023822d20